Python QListWidget当前选中的行

Python QListWidget当前选中的行

Python QListWidget当前选中的行
(图片来源网络,侵删)

小标题:获取QListWidget中当前选中的行

单元表格:

功能 代码示例
获取QListWidget中当前选中的行 currentRow()
获取QListWidget中指定行的文本 item(row).text()
获取QListWidget中指定行的图标 item(row).icon()
获取QListWidget中指定行的字体 item(row).font()

代码示例:

from PyQt5.QtWidgets import QApplication, QListWidget, QListWidgetItem
import sys
app = QApplication(sys.argv)
list_widget = QListWidget()
添加一些项目到列表中
for i in range(10):
    item = QListWidgetItem(f"Item {i}")
    list_widget.addItem(item)
获取当前选中的行
selected_row = list_widget.currentRow()
print(f"当前选中的行: {selected_row}")
获取指定行的文本、图标和字体
item = list_widget.item(selected_row)
text = item.text()
icon = item.icon()
font = item.font()
print(f"选中行的文本: {text}")
print(f"选中行的图标: {icon}")
print(f"选中行的字体: {font}")
list_widget.show()
sys.exit(app.exec_())

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/480371.html

本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
未希的头像未希新媒体运营
上一篇 2024-04-15 19:38
下一篇 2024-04-15 19:40

相关推荐

  • 如何实现服务器外网访问外网?

    服务器外网访问外网的实现方式主要依赖于网络配置、安全设置以及必要的硬件和软件支持,以下是详细的步骤说明:一、获取公共IP地址1、申请公共IP:需要向互联网服务提供商(ISP)申请一个公共IP地址,这个IP地址将用于服务器在互联网上的标识,2、配置网络连接:在服务器上配置网络连接,包括设置IP地址、子网掩码、网关……

    2024-12-14
    00
  • 如何高效进行服务器大数据迁移?

    服务器大数据迁移背景和重要性在现代企业中,数据是至关重要的资产之一,随着业务的增长和技术的不断进步,服务器的数据量也在迅速膨胀,为了适应这种变化,企业可能需要对服务器进行升级、更换或迁移到云平台,这一过程并非简单,需要详细的规划和执行,以确保数据的完整性和安全性,本文将详细介绍服务器大数据迁移的步骤和注意事项……

    2024-12-14
    00
  • 服务器大数据版本,如何优化性能与存储管理?

    服务器大数据版本1. 引言在当今数字化时代,数据已成为企业最宝贵的资产之一,随着互联网和物联网技术的飞速发展,数据量呈现爆炸性增长,传统的数据处理方式已经难以满足需求,大数据技术应运而生,并在各个领域得到了广泛应用,本文将深入探讨服务器大数据版本的概念、特点、应用场景以及面临的挑战和解决方案,为企业在数字化转型……

    2024-12-14
    00
  • 服务器夜神模拟器,这款模拟器有何独特之处?

    服务器夜神模拟器背景介绍夜神模拟器是一款广泛使用的安卓模拟器,允许用户在电脑上运行Android应用程序和游戏,随着云计算技术的发展,很多用户希望在云服务器上安装并使用夜神模拟器,以便实现24小时不间断运行应用或进行多开操作,本文将详细介绍如何在云服务器上安装和使用夜神模拟器,包括所需的硬件配置、操作系统选择……

    2024-12-14
    00

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

产品购买 QQ咨询 微信咨询 SEO优化
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购 >>点击进入